Action Plan

You can get help with your billing issues. Contact the agency managing your workers’ compensation claim.

 

Reach out to the Federal Employees’ Compensation Program.

Have questions about your claim? Call the Federal Employees’ Compensation Program at 202-513-6860 on Monday – Friday between 9:30am – 6:30pm ET.

You can also use the Compensation Program’s website (ECOMP) to check on the status of your claim.
